Magic Drawing App (Free) - Magic is designed to let you create drawings with your Mac's trackpad. The drawings can be exported as regular images so you can share them anywhere. Magic, a free macOS newly created by a young developer named João Gabriel, lets you produce drawings with your fingers on your Mac’s trackpad.

There are also four different background options, including lines and squares. If your Mac has a Force Touch trackpad, the app also identifies pressure levels to automatically adjust the brush - but there are manual options as well. All you have to do is click on the canvas and then start drawing on the trackpad exactly where you want it. There’s not much you need to know before using the Magic app for the first time since it basically turns the trackpad into a tablet.
